Modeling multi-level survival data in multi-center epidemiological cohort studies: Applications from the ELAPSE project

Background: We evaluated methods for the analysis of multi-level survival data using a pooled dataset of 14 cohorts participating in the ELAPSE project investigating associations between residential exposure to low levels of air pollution (PM2.5 and NO2) and health (natural-cause mortality and cereb...
